diff options
author | Wilmer van der Gaast <wilmer@gaast.net> | 2011-04-18 15:47:36 +0200 |
---|---|---|
committer | Wilmer van der Gaast <wilmer@gaast.net> | 2011-04-18 15:47:36 +0200 |
commit | d43d55a4c55b1c75d29831a825978541f8356419 (patch) | |
tree | 5fcba566f8ad8b473b56a7a71189535db1777cb3 | |
parent | 6220254c1ecebce81ab765260ec0af3c3818f9a6 (diff) |
Fix GnuTLS >2.12 or so compatibility.
Bug #779 and https://savannah.gnu.org/support/index.php?107660
-rw-r--r-- | lib/ssl_gnutls.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/lib/ssl_gnutls.c b/lib/ssl_gnutls.c index cdc7c498..72517e72 100644 --- a/lib/ssl_gnutls.c +++ b/lib/ssl_gnutls.c @@ -134,6 +134,7 @@ static gboolean ssl_connected( gpointer data, gint source, b_input_condition con gnutls_certificate_allocate_credentials( &conn->xcred ); gnutls_init( &conn->session, GNUTLS_CLIENT ); + gnutls_transport_set_lowat( conn->session, 1 ); gnutls_set_default_priority( conn->session ); gnutls_credentials_set( conn->session, GNUTLS_CRD_CERTIFICATE, conn->xcred ); |